Demystifying Z-Scores in Lean Six Sigma: A Practical Guide
Z-scores are a crucial tool in the Lean Six Sigma methodology. They quantify how much a data point differs from the average. By transforming raw data into uniform values, Z-scores allow a more concise understanding of individual data points relative the complete dataset. Utilizing Z-scores can improve process monitoring.
